> >> "SQL Server does not exist or access denied" means that either the server
> >> was not found or it rejected your connection.
> >> It did not even get to SQL Server on the server.
> >>
> >> Check that you host is pingable and that the firewall on the server
> >> allows
> >> for connections on the SQL Server port.
